Hello! This is AfreecaTV.

ASL Season 4 is finally starting on September 10th at 7:00PM KST with StarCraft Remastered.

Until now, AfreecaTV has constantly supported users and streamers who have enjoyed SC BW for the past two years with three consecutive seasons of ASL.

With the new release of SCR, we are pleased to announce ASL Season 4 along with English casters to support our global audience.

However, we would like to inform you that ASL Season 4 will not be streamed on Twitch or YouTube

We understand that our global fans find Twitch to be the most convenient and familiar platform for esports.

Time after time, AfreecaTV has generously invested into the past three seasons of ASL. And despite Twitch being a competitor, AfreecaTV has provided free English casting for ASL.

As you may already know, ASL Season 4 has undergone many financial challenges. From increased prize pools for players to enhanced production value, it has grown since ASL Season 3.

In order to securely maintain ASL, AfreecaTV currently conducts content sales with its sponsors.

Due to this, from the policy of providing ASL for free to Twitch, we have decided to sell media rights of our ASL English content to Twitch and YouTube.

Yet as an agreement could not be reached with Twitch or YouTube for ASL media rights, we could not provide them with ASL content for the start of Season 4.

This is an already established business model for numerous fields of esports and sports.

For our global fans and their love for SC BW and SCR, AfreecaTV is currently preparing its servers, so that users can watch with very little discomfort.

We hope that you will watch ASL S4 on AfreecaTV, as Tasteless and Artosis will continue to cast.

Here is the link for watching ASL S4

Thank you.

Unfortunately ASL on twitch did a great job displaying BW to an audience who does not usually watch BW, and even perhaps a lot of people who have never watched BW or have no connection at all to the game (SC2 fans for example).

I think us dedicated fans of BW you find here on TL.net will do everything within their power to watch your tournament, so re-streaming ASL to VLC or watching on afreeca wont be an issue for most of us, but I fear it's terrible news for the western bw world and it's potential growth. Having your game being high rank on twitch will naturally make more people check it out, and ASL did a great job of that.
